Gary Johnson (England) 25/10/04


Played this course on Sat 23 October 2004, as part of a weekend golf trip, & although it poured with rain all the way round the course was still in fabulous condition although some standing water was evident on some of the greens & in places on the fairways. Fairly undulating with distance from several greens to next tee, but the course is generally well laid out and fair, with good direction signs to the next hole, the clubhouse is good with excellent bar menu showers & changing facilities, drink prices are quite steep but nothing compared to the main hotel bar where a gin & tonic and a Jack Daniels & coke came to over £10 (singles not doubles). Overall as part of a weekend break deal including the hotel this is worth considering. Stratford is very close by and good for a night out without seeing trouble with good pubs & bars.

P Boyce (England) 17/08/04


My wife and I played in August after the recent heavy rains. The course is well drained and the greens are fast and true. The greens are quite hard to read. The bunkers are positioned well and in great condition. The golf holes were varied with the last four the most scenic. My wife found the course long as the ladies 'T's were only a few yards in front of the mens. The course is fairly undulating but the Buggy's were quite expensive (£25). All in all a very nice Golf Course. The Clubhouse is new and clean but the prices are steep, eespecially the non-alchoholic (£2.50 for a pint of Lime and Lemonade !!!). The Golf Course is still in the Corporate mode but trying to entice the general public in as it was a very quiet course. No surprise with the prices they charge !!
